Question One World - Circle atlantic

Has anyone booked a Circle Atlantic fare? I was interested in a 17,000 mile South America>Europe>North America>South America however the kind folk at AA reservations had no idea the fare existed... Has anyone booked one of these fares and provide a rough price guide - trying to decide if it is worth looking into. Thanks

Never booked one
but here are the base fares ex-Buenos Aires (source ExpertFlyer)
LCIRAT17 USD3000
DCIRAT17 USD8000
ACIRAT17 USD10800

Awesome, thanks ! Do those prices include airport taxes?
No. All OW base fares need taxes & carrier fees (fuel surcharges, etc) added, as these are carrier & route dependant

Did you call regular AA reservations or the AA RTW desk? Regular AA reservations wouldn't be expected to have much (if any) knowledge of the oneworld rtw or circle products.

I haven't looked at the circle atlantic for some time but I never saw much value there when compared to other products.

Just checked, and I agree with you jerry a.laska
The base fare for an ex-Argentina DONE4 is USD9299

So for USD1299 more than the DCIRAT17 you'll get Asia, no mileage restrictions and fewer stopover restrictions
